Visa Innovator

Novator Visa is designed for experienced entrepreneurs seeking to open or grow their business in the UK.

To obtain a visa, applicants must offer an innovative, viable and scalable business idea that will receive the approval of an organization authorized by the Home Office.

In most cases, the applicant will also need to demonstrate the availability of at least £ 50,000 to invest in a future company. Applicants can form a team with other applicants for an innovator visa, each of which must have an amount of at least £ 50,000.

The initial visa is issued for 3 years. The visa holder can extend it for another 3 years or (subject to certain conditions) apply for permanent residence.

The key requirement for obtaining an innovator visa is a written confirmation from an organization (Endorsing Body) authorized by the Ministry of the Interior. The business ideas expressed in the applications must meet the criteria of innovation, vitality and scalability.

The conditions for applying for an innovator visa

  • Applicant must be over 18 years old.
  • A business (or business project) must receive approval from an authorized organization
  • The approval of the authorized organization must be valid at the time of filing and consideration of the application.
  • Applicants must have sufficient capital to live in the UK.
  • Applicants must be proficient in English at least B2 on the CEFR (Common European Framework of Reference) scale.

Investment Requirements:

  • When creating a new company, the applicant must have at least £ 50,000. The source of the funds does not matter.
  • Applicants may form a team with other Novator visa applicants, but may not use the same investment. Each applicant must have an amount of at least £ 50,000.

Innovator Visa Extension Terms

  • Still developing a business in the UK or striving to open a new one.
  • Own a business that has already been approved as part of the Novator Visa.
  • Have the opportunity to invest £ 50,000 – if the applicant seeks to open a new business in the UK, approved by an authorized organization.
  • Have enough cash to support yourself without applying for public funding.
  • Include all dependents mentioned in the application for a current visa in the application for its extension, including children who are over 18 years of age during their stay in the UK.

Holders of the Novator visa can apply for permanent residence after 5 years of residence in the country or after 3 years if their business is working especially well.

To do this, the business must demonstrate significant achievements within the framework of the business plan approved upon receipt of the initial visa.

One year after receiving permanent residence, the applicant can apply for citizenship, provided that the total period of his stay in the country is at least 5 years.

Conditions for obtaining a permanent residence permit (ILR)

  • Stay in the UK for at least 3 years before applying.
  • To be in the UK on an innovator visa.
  • Demonstrate the necessary knowledge of the English language and pass the test “Life in the UK” (test for knowledge of the laws, history and social structure of the UK).
